Dilation is a transformation that resizes a geometrical shape while maintaining its orientation. This transformation results in similar shapes. It is called enlargement when a …

A … Web- the enlargement or reduction of a figure - the scale factor indicates how much the figure will enlarge or reduce - variable for scale factor = k When k > 1, the dilation is an enlargement. Since figures are similar if one is the result of reflecting, rotating, translating, and dilating the other, and figures are congruent only as a result of the rigid transformations, congruent figures are similar but not vice versa.
